Summary
Overview
Work History
Education
Skills
Recognition
Timeline
SoftwareDeveloper
RAHUL Jain

RAHUL Jain

Software Developer
K-3/10 Street 10, Gangotri Vihar, New Delhi

Summary

  • Achievement-driven professional with an experience of 9 years in application development, enhancement, and service delivery.
  • Communicating with internal/external clients to determine specific requirements and expectations; managing client expectations as an indicator of quality
  • Extensive exposure and skills in Software Development Lifecycle (SDLC) right from requirement analysis, documentation (functional specifications, technical design), coding, and testing (preparation of test cases along with implementation) to the maintenance of proposed applications

Overview

9
9
years of professional experience

Work History

Engineering Manager

Glance (Inmobi Group)
Bangalore
01.2023 - Current
  • Build an programmatic web SDK which serves almost 100 million ads on all glance and external properties.
  • Design and build a mediation SDK that mediates between multiple ad providers and serves the ad as per the chooses one.
  • Build an Analytics system in web SDK to better track the numbers which resulted in additional ~5k USD revenue/day.
  • Build an Integration testing pipeline using cypress resulting in 60% of regression efforts.
  • Enable open measurement in all video ads resulting in 3x ecpm.

SDE 3

Glance (Inmobi Group)
Bangalore
08.2021 - 01.2023
  • Build an LMS (Lead Management System) Solution from scratch to capture leads on lock-screen
  • The solution included building a virtual keyboard and integrating with Pulse (the biggest survey platform in Inmobi) system
  • Led a team to build GAMx (Glance Ad Manager) to control the ad management from Glance
  • GAMx was configured to control all types of ads (Direct or programmatic), and surfaces (Lockscree, highlights, or Roposo) and was able to show all the ads-related info in a clean dashboard with proper history and revenue
  • Build a solution to show banner and video ads on Glance Live to increase revenue
  • Develop a solution to measure viewability for video ads
  • Thie helped our clients to verify whether video ads are properly visible to the users
  • Developed a Tool (Oriana) For Fast shipping of webpeeks on the lock screen
  • This Tool was very helpful for the delivery team as it reduced manual efforts and helped speed up of the delivery.

Lead Engineer

dunnhumby
Gurgaon
03.2018 - 08.2021
  • Build an internal component library like Bootstrap and used it as an NPM package in all dunnhumby projects to speed up the development and achieve the same user interface across all products
  • Led a team of 6 members to successfully migrate a project on Adobe Flash to
  • React JS and containerize it to deploy for 23 clients
  • Conducted training and onboarded clients to provide knowledge on new applications
  • Build an automated spec-builder that creates a gitbook from markdown files provided by the user
  • Markdown files were mapped with business rules which were selected by users from the application which resulted in a reduction of user efforts by around 80%.

Senior Associate

Nagarro
Gurgaon
08.2014 - 02.2018
  • Developed multiple full-stack apps using the MERN stack
  • Build a Rule Configurator for adding business rules which were further used to create a workflow
  • The workflow was executed in a WCF service which was consumed in multiple applications
  • Any change in business rules was made through the rule configurator which reduced development and deployment efforts by 80%
  • Optimized web applications by identifying multiple scenarios like moving validations from server-side to client-side using jquery, merging HTTP Requests, and using caching on both server-side and client-side
  • Improved the code coverage of a project in angular(2.0) from 30% to 90%
  • MIgrated 47 client applications from IE7 to IE9 and the project was delivered one month earlier than the deadline.

Education

Bachelor of Technology(B.tech) - Information technology, Engineering

Bharti VidyaPeeth College of Engineering

12th - Science

Little Flowers Public School

Skills

    Javsacript,React js,Next js, Node js, HTML, CSS

undefined

Recognition

  • Recognized with the 'Bond 007' award for 2 consecutive years for swiftly developing a programmatic web SDK.

Timeline

Engineering Manager

Glance (Inmobi Group)
01.2023 - Current

SDE 3

Glance (Inmobi Group)
08.2021 - 01.2023

Lead Engineer

dunnhumby
03.2018 - 08.2021

Senior Associate

Nagarro
08.2014 - 02.2018

Bachelor of Technology(B.tech) - Information technology, Engineering

Bharti VidyaPeeth College of Engineering

12th - Science

Little Flowers Public School
RAHUL JainSoftware Developer